Assuming you are talking about the Linux binary, you'll need SFML 1.6 installed (not really a safe, clean way to make that portable). On Ubuntu the packages 'libsfml-graphics1.6 libsfml-system1.6 libsfml-window1.6' should do the trick; most distros should have similar named packages. Alternatively, you can download the binaries directly from the SFML developer.
